The optional supervision layer (RFC §8): one service runs everything in <config_dir>/scripts/ plus installed punktfunk-plugin-* packages (<config_dir>/plugins/node_modules/), as Effect fibers. - Plugins (a definePlugin default export, either main shape) are SUPERVISED: a failure restarts them with capped exponential backoff (jittered, 1s→60s); a clean return completes them. The Effect shape runs under the PunktfunkHost layer; the async-fn shape gets a facade client whose close is scope-guaranteed. - Bare scripts are one-shot: importing them is the run, no restart (export a plugin to be supervised). - Shutdown is STRUCTURAL: SIGINT/SIGTERM interrupt the whole fiber tree, so Effect plugins' scoped finalizers run and clients close before exit — the systemctl-stop story, and the reason the Effect plugin shape exists at all. - The sshd rule applies to unit files (world-writable → refused loudly); cache-busted imports make restarts real; --list for inventory. 6 new bun tests (17 total green): discovery + refusal, both plugin shapes against a mock host, crash→restart with backoff, one-shot semantics, and finalizer-on-interrupt. Live-verified against a real host: a supervised watcher plugin received library.changed through the pinned tunnel, and SIGTERM shut the tree down structurally (exit 0). # @punktfunk/host
|
|
|
|
TypeScript SDK for the [punktfunk](https://git.unom.io/unom/punktfunk) streaming host: a typed
|
|
management-API client plus the host's lifecycle **event stream** (client connect/disconnect,
|
|
stream start/stop, pairing, displays, library) — built on [Effect](https://effect.website).
|
|
|
|
Two surfaces, one core:
|
|
|
|
- **`@punktfunk/host`** — the Promise facade, the front door. `connect()`, `await`, `.on()`.
|
|
You never need to know Effect exists.
|
|
- **`@punktfunk/host/effect`** — the Effect-native surface for plugins and composed programs:
|
|
the `PunktfunkHost` service + layer, `Stream`-based events, typed errors
|
|
(`AuthError | ApiError | TransportError | VersionSkew`), and every wire shape as an
|
|
`effect/Schema` (REST shapes generated from the host's OpenAPI spec; event shapes mirroring
|
|
the host's snapshot-tested wire format).
|

## Connection resolution
|
|
|
|
`connect()` / `PunktfunkHostLive()` resolve, in order:
|
|
|
|
| What | Source |
|
|
|---|---|
|
|
| URL | `{ url }` → `PUNKTFUNK_MGMT_URL` → `https://127.0.0.1:47990` |
|
|
| Token | `{ token }` → `PUNKTFUNK_MGMT_TOKEN` → `<config_dir>/mgmt-token` |
|
|
| TLS pin | `{ ca }` → `PUNKTFUNK_MGMT_CA` (path) → `<config_dir>/cert.pem` |
|
|
|
|
`<config_dir>` is `~/.config/punktfunk` (Linux/macOS) or `%ProgramData%\punktfunk` (Windows) —
|
|
so a script running on the host box needs **zero configuration**. The TLS pin trusts exactly
|
|
the host's self-signed identity cert (chain-verified; the hostname check is waived — the cert
|
|
is deliberately CN-only, native clients pin its fingerprint). Bun and Node are first-class;
|
|
other runtimes fall back to system trust (point your runtime's CA option at `cert.pem`).
|
|
|
|
The bearer token is the host's **admin** credential and is honored from loopback only — run
|
|
scripts on the host box (or through an SSH tunnel).
|
|
|
|
## Events
|
|
|
|
- Reconnects automatically (exponential backoff + jitter, capped) and resumes with
|
|
`Last-Event-ID` — the host replays what you missed from its ring.
|
|
- Default is **live tail only** (a fresh notify script must not re-fire on history);
|
|
pass `{ since: 0 }` on the Effect surface to replay the host's full ring, or `since: N`
|
|
to resume after a seq you persisted.
|
|
- `on()` patterns: exact kinds (`"stream.started"`, typed callback), `"domain.*"` prefixes,
|
|
`"*"`, plus `"dropped"` (your cursor fell off the ring — resync via REST) and `"unknown"`
|
|
(an event kind newer than this SDK — the additive-only wire at work).
|
|
- Effect surface: `events()` is a `Stream<HostEvent, EventStreamError>`; `eventsRaw()` carries
|
|
every SSE frame verbatim.
|
|

## The runner: `punktfunk-scripting`
|
|
|
|
Instead of one unit file per script, run everything under the managed runner — it discovers
|
|
your units and supervises them:
|
|
|
|
```sh
|
|
bun src/runner-cli.ts # runs <config_dir>/scripts/* + installed punktfunk-plugin-*
|
|
bun src/runner-cli.ts --list # show what it found
|
|
```
|
|
|
|
- **Plugins** (a `definePlugin` default export, from the scripts dir or a
|
|
`punktfunk-plugin-*` package installed under `<config_dir>/plugins/`): supervised — a crash
|
|
restarts them with capped exponential backoff; a clean return completes them.
|
|
- **Bare scripts**: importing them is the run — one-shot, no restart (export a plugin to be
|
|
supervised).
|
|
- **Shutdown is structural**: SIGINT/SIGTERM interrupt every unit's fiber — Effect plugins'
|
|
scoped finalizers run (release the preset, deregister cleanly) and facade clients close
|
|
before the process exits. This is what makes `systemctl stop` clean.
|
|
- The sshd rule applies: a group/world-writable unit file is refused loudly.
|
|
|

## Compatibility
|
|
|
|
- SDK **majors** track the management-API major; an event `schema` bump or an `effect` major
|
|
is an SDK major too.
|
|
- The wire is **additive-only** within a major: an older SDK keeps working against a newer
|
|
host (unknown response keys are ignored; unknown event kinds ride the `"unknown"` channel).
|
|
- A 2xx response that doesn't match its schema surfaces as `VersionSkew` on the Effect
|
|
surface — a typed nudge to update, not an `undefined` three frames later.
|
